Are you spending most of your family history research time clicking on hints rather than bringing your research together? As part of our 90th birthday celebrations and National Family History Month join us for a session thinking about ways to do something wonderful with your family history - including publishing and creative works.

The session will be chaired by Society CEO Ruth Graham and feature panel members Andrew Redfern, Kerry Forsythe and Caylie Jeffery from Paddington Then and Now, cookbook compiler Lee McKerracher, blogger Anthea Gupta, Philippa Shelley Jones from Record My Past, and Pamela Proestos from the National Maritime Museum.
